BOILING SPRINGS, N.C.鈥擝ig South Conference Commissioner Kyle B. Kallander announced Wednesday (Jan. 18) that 爱污传媒 President Dr. William Downs has been selected to serve as Big South Vice President of the Executive Committee. Since September 2022, Downs has served on the Executive Committee as at At-Large Member.

By serving in this leadership role, Downs elevates 爱污传媒鈥檚 involvement and commitment to the Big South Conference and its student-athletes.

鈥淓veryone who works with me knows how passionate I am about the success of our student-athletes at 爱污传媒,鈥 Downs shared. 鈥淔or the Runnin鈥 Bulldogs to be successful, we must be part of a strong, nimble, and innovative conference. As vice president of the Big South Executive Committee, I am committed to enhancing the competitive standing of all our member institutions across the full range of sports in which we compete. There鈥檚 so much uncertainty presently swirling around the world of NCAA athletics, and in the Big South we have to mitigate the distractions by rededicating ourselves to student-athlete excellence in all its forms鈥攊n the classroom, on the fields of competition, and in the community. If we do that, there will indeed be big times ahead for the Big South.鈥

Matt vandenBerg, president at Presbyterian College in Clinton, S.C., has agreed to serve in the At-Large position on the Executive Committee through the remainder of this academic year. 

爱污传媒 Vice President and Director of Athletics Dr. Andrew T. Goodrich said Downs is highly regarded in the conference. 鈥淥n behalf of all the Athletic Directors in the Big South, we are excited to see Dr. Downs enter into this leadership role,鈥 Goodrich observed. 鈥淗is vision and guidance will prove effective as we enter this new era of NCAA governance.鈥

The Big South Conference Executive Committee has the authority to make decisions, when necessary, for the Big South Council of Chief Executive Officers. Additionally, the Executive Committee hears any appeals regarding penalties imposed by the Commissioner.

Since his arrival on the GWU campus in 2019, Downs has enthusiastically supported the University鈥檚 over 600 student-athletes and 22 NCAA Division I teams. He also led the first athletics brand update in more than 35 years.

Downs鈥 career spans over two decades of service in higher education. Before GWU, he was dean of the Thomas Harriot College of Arts & Sciences at East Carolina University (ECU) in Greenville, N.C. He had been at ECU since 2014 and was also the W. Keats Sparrow Distinguished Chair in the Liberal Arts and a professor of political science. He鈥檚 also held positions at Georgia State University and was a research fellow at Harvard University鈥檚 Minda de Gunzburg Center for European Studies.

A Raleigh, N.C., native, Downs earned his Bachelor of Arts in political science (with a minor in journalism) from North Carolina State University (Raleigh) in 1988, and his Master of Arts (鈥90) and Doctoral (鈥94) degrees in political science from Emory University (Atlanta). Downs is married to Kimberly Harwood Downs, and they have two children, Rachel and Bradley.
